Song meaning for I Wanna by Brandon Ravenell

The song "I Wanna" by Brandon Ravenell is a seductive and confident track that explores the desires and intentions of the artist. The lyrics depict a strong attraction towards someone, with the artist expressing his longing for their presence and intimacy. The song opens with an infectious and catchy intro, setting the tone for the passionate and sensual journey that lies ahead.

In the first verse, Brandon Ravenell expresses his admiration for the person he desires, referring to them as his "baby." He emphasizes his genuine interest in getting to know them beyond physical intimacy, wanting to connect with their soul and mind. The artist invites the person to come closer and promises that he won't harm them, expressing his desire to see them in a white dress, symbolizing purity and innocence.

The pre-chorus highlights the artist's dedication and affection towards the person, mentioning how he thinks about them even during his professional commitments. He considers them to be of utmost importance in his life, and he wants to showcase them in the spotlight, indicating his desire to make them feel special and valued.

The chorus reinforces the artist's intentions, as he proclaims that he wants to pick the person up and take them down, symbolizing a passionate and intimate encounter. He wants to mix things up and break it down, indicating his desire to explore different aspects of their relationship. The artist acknowledges the person's irresistible allure and assures them that they won't be going anywhere, suggesting his commitment and dedication to them.

In the second verse, Brandon Ravenell asserts his independence and self-sufficiency, stating that he doesn't need anyone else but acknowledges the excitement and joy the person brings into his life. He wants to create a memorable experience with them, igniting a fire that will burn until they part ways. The artist assures the person that he will take care of the tempo, indicating his ability to lead and guide them through their journey together.

Overall, "I Wanna" by Brandon Ravenell is a song that explores the artist's desires and intentions towards someone he deeply admires. It showcases his confidence, passion, and commitment to making the person feel special and cherished. The lyrics paint a picture of a passionate and intimate connection, emphasizing the artist's longing for a deeper emotional and physical bond.
